UBC Okanagan - Psychology Clinic

Offers evidence-based psychological care at a lower cost for adults, including UBC Okanagan faculty, staff, students, and the broader Okanagan community. Also offers psychoeducational assessments and neuropsychological assessments. Services provided by student therapists under supervision of registered clinical psychologists and neuropsychologists. Eligibility and fees for each service are determined by a variety of factors; these are discussed individually with each client or referral source. The Problematic Substance Use Clinic is a low-barrier outpatient treatment service for individuals seeking help to reduce harm associated with their use of alcohol or other substances. Treatment provided by doctoral level psychology students under supervision of a psychologist who is an expert in the field of substance use. Fees for services are on a sliding scale based on income, and range from $10 to $80 per hour. Accepts referrals from self or others. Hours are 8:00 am to 4:00 pm Monday to Friday.
